Word broke yesterday about Courtney Love losing custody of her 17-year old daughter Frances Bean. Frances is the only child of Love and deceased Nirvana frontman Kurt Cobain. For the most part, Frances has led a pretty quiet life away from the spotlight, but in the last year there have been rumors and mumblings she's tried to distance herself from her increasingly erratic mother.
The official word is a guardianship was set up for Frances, appointing Kurt's mom, Wendy Cobain, and his sister, Kimberly Dawn, as the guardians. The guardianship was set up to protect Frances Bean and her financial future, however, the guardians have no stake in the trust set up after Kurt Cobain's death. Courtney and her behavior are at the center of the guardianship and the courts and lawyers had plenty of ammunition in proving Courtney was unfit to act on Frances' best behalf.
Courtney, who was in court recently for a lawsuit brought against her on defamation charges, has been all over the tabloids due to her sometimes insane social media ramblings on both Twitter and Facebook and occasionally her own blog. Courtney spoke out about the guardianship and her daughter on her Facebook with mixed reactions to her typically indecipherable blather, including comments about her parenting style, her publicly airing private matters, and, oddly, years old references to her involvement in Kurt's death, which was ruled a suicide.
